    Anyone running exhaust that ends underneath the bike? I'm thinking a couple of shorty mufflers underneath, ending 10 or 12 inches in front of the rear tire. As long as I don't run open pipes without a muffler on there, I should be alright for backpressure/runability, right?

    I really want to get my cans off the sides. I've got a couple of little leaks, and they're bugging the crap outta me.

    I don't see why not. It should work with 4 mufflers (shorties) and get some kind of turn-outs to get the exhaust from blowing directly at the tire. It should sound pretty mean too!!
    You will need to do some fine tuning with the carbs, because you will have no collector to equalize the back pressure in your exhaust.
